It's pretty good, we tested one with a mains grinder in my garage a couple days ago. It can be grinded but its a fair bit of faff, took 5 discs - which I doubt anyone is going to bother with on the side of the road. I was messing round for 20 mins.
Even then, because they've made it so the D doesn't twist in the main lock body you may have to make a second cut to get it off if its over a part of the bike more than 20-30mm thick.
I imagine in the real world the thief would move on after their first disc dissolves  |
